Dobis is our 100% Citra hopped pale ale that starts with lots of Scottish Golden Promise malt to create a graham cracker base. Then Citra brings forth lots of pineapple, mandarin, citrus, and mango. We love Citra, it is super juicy and flavorful. This is the first beer in a long line of brews that we make hopped only with it. Cheers to the OG Dobis!

Very hazy but translucent, pale yellow, basically straw in color. Capped with a foamy white head with great retention.

Nice popping fruity aroma, huge honeydew melon, white grape, pineapple, some lemon and unripe mango.

Tastes follows as honeydew melon, white grape, tart pineapple, lemon, grass, and clean, white crackery/raw doughy malt. Perhaps a touch of nutty oat. Clean finish, no real bitterness at all but the lemon peel/pineapple scrubs clean the palate.

Somewhat hefty body, moderately carbonated, smooth and silky but still easy to drink.

Excellent New England style pale ale! I'd happily buy/drink this again.

On tap at Cellarmaker House of Pizza

A: Pours hazy golden amber with a frothy off white head that settles to a light layer and laces beautifully.

S: Bright mix of tropical, stone fruit, and citrus, grassy, slightly resinous, a bit floral, crackery biscuity malt, and a little caramel sweetness.

T: Bright, tropical and stone fruit, pineapple, mango, apricot, and peach, lemon, lime, and tangerine, grassy, floral, a bit resinous, faintly herbal, crackery biscuity malt, and a touch of caramel sweetness.

M: Light to medium body, moderately lovely carbonation.

O: One of the OG Cellarmaker beers. Super crisp and crushable, and distinctly different from other Citra beers. Love it!
